Percentage Increase :-
In August, Audra worked a total of 35 hours, in September she worked 45.5 hours – by what percentage did Audra’s working hours increase in September?
Solution.
Difference between the no. of hours worked = 45.5-35 = 10.5
% Increase = 10.5/35 *100 = 30%
Thus, Audra’s working hours increased by 30% from August to September.
Percentage decrease :-
The price of a dozen eggs was $2.29, but is now $2.09. What is the percent decrease?
Solution.
Difference between the prices = $(2.29-2.09) = $ 0.20
% Decrease = 0.20/2.29 * 100 = 8.73%

5. Give one real- world example(question) of reverse percentages and show your calculations to find the answer?
Ans. A TV costs $350 after a 25% discount. Find out the original price of the TV.
Solution.
Let the original cost of the the TV be $100.
∴ the cost after a discount of 25% = $100- $25 = $75
Thus, the original price of the TV = 350 ÷ 75/100 =$466.67

Ans. Direct proportion :-
The circumference c of a circle is directly proportional to its diameter d.
We know, Circumference of a circle (C) = 2πr [r is the radius of the circe]
∴ C = πd [Diameter( d)=2r]
∵ π is constant
∴ C ∝ d
Eg.,
Let thediameter of circle A be d cm . How does the circumference change If the diameter is doubled or quadrupled?
For circle A, diameter(d1) = 4 cm
∴ Circumference (C1) = dπ cm
When diameter is doubled, diameter(d2) = 2d cm
∴ Circumference (C2) = (2d)π cm = 2(dπ) cm = 2C1
When diameter is quadrupled, diameter(d3) = 4d cm
∴ Circumference (C3) = (4d)π cm = 4(dπ) cm = 4C1
Thus, when the diameter of the circle is doubled or quadrupled, the circumference also gets doubled and quadrupled respectively.
